Breaking Down the Financial Barrier

Buyers of traditional cars usually have to put down a deposit, which can be from 10% to 30% of the car’s value. Saving this much is an obstacle for younger buyers or for those just beginning their careers. Deposit-free car loans remove this requirement and leave them to their monthly payments. This is good news for people who are not able to save up for a car, such as new graduates and people in the early stages of their careers.

Flexibility in Loan Terms

Flexible repayment terms on deposit-free car loans make them even more appealing to first time buyers. Such loan periods can be from 24 months to several years, according to the buyer’s will. This flexibility frees people to manage their payments to meet their budget, further reducing financial burden. Car financing companies give buyers the choice of customizing their terms so that they can also afford their other essential expenses.

Building Credit History

If you have little or no credit, getting a car loan is an essential first step toward establishing a solid financial history. Car loans without deposit can be an excellent opportunity for first time buyers to build their credit history. But by making regular monthly payments on time, buyers show that they can handle debt creditably. If they do choose to borrow money for a car, it not only helps them with their car financing but it also gives them a better chance of getting other financial products such as a credit card or mortgage in the future.
